>I am going to paint my '76 Spit.  Probalbly using the K-mart spray can
>method.
>What tools do I use to prepare the surface for paint.  I have some rust
>on the trunk lid.  Do I need a special sander or just my $20.00 electric
>drill with some fancy attachment?  Should I prime the entire car?  What
color
>primer?

However you sand it down, etc., don't omit the essential step of (minimally)
metal-prepping before priming, and (preferably) conversion coating as well.
 All in all, it's not a hard job, just a lot of surface to go over and over
and over and over, even on a Spit!
